35.

Three boys agree to divide a bag of marbles in the following manner. The first boy takes one more than half the marbles. The second takes a third of the number remaining. The third boy finds that he is left with twice as many marbles as the second boy. The original number of marbles:

is none of the following

cannot be determined from the given data

is 2020 or 2626

is 1414 or 3232

is 88 or 3838

Answer: B

Solution:

The first boy takes n2+1,\frac{n}{2}+1, leaving n21.\frac{n}{2}-1. The second takes one third of that remainder, and the third receives the other two thirds, automatically twice the second boy’s share. Thus the share condition imposes no unique value of n.n. It only requires n21\frac{n}{2}-1 to be a nonnegative multiple of 3,3, so many values such as 8,14,20,26,8,14,20,26,\ldots work.

Therefore the original number cannot be determined, and the correct answer is B.
